Why is it important to clean the vacuum cleaner filter?

Many people know that after using a vacuum cleaner they should empty it, ready to be used the next time. By having an empty vacuum cleaner, the pick up efficiency will be better. However, what many people are not aware of is that it is vital to the performance of your vacuum cleaner that you regularly clean the vacuum cleaner filter too.

To keep any bagless vacuum cleaner in good working order, cleaning the filter is a must. When the filter is clogged, even just a little, there will be a noticeable loss in suction and the machine might also start making noises that indicate it is struggling to perform at it’s best. if you are noticing either of these things then cleaning the filter is certainly overdue.

Once you have located where the filter is on your vacuum cleaner, remove it from the machine, and tap it briskly to remove any debris. Next, you should wash the filter under running water, lukewarm is best, and then leave it to dry naturally for at least 24 hours before putting it back into the vacuum cleaner. Your machine will have more than one filter, however not all will be washable, so you should refer to your user guide to make sure you have done what can be done.

You shouldn’t wait until the filter clogs up before you clean it. As a general rule, clean the filter once a week if you are using the machine on a daily basis, or once a month is sufficient is you use it less than this. Cleaning the filter is crucial to you getting the peak performance out of your vacuum cleaner, and also it will stop the machine from harbouring dusty foul smells too.
